MATTHEW Leuenberger has uttered the words every Brisbane Lions fan wants to hear – he's not going anywhere.
The 24-year-old ruckman is out of contract at the end of the season and recent media speculation has swirled around interest from cashed-up expansion club Greater Western Sydney.
But Leuenberger said despite not starting negotiations with the Lions at this stage, he was determined to stay in Brisbane.
"I've got no intentions of leaving. I love it here," Leuenberger told AFL.com.au after the win against Melbourne on Sunday.
"I think good things are about to come. I haven't hung around here for this long to leave as soon as it's starting to come good, so I've got no intentions of leaving."
